Keanu Reeves Net Worth 2026 – Early Life & Background
Keanu Charles Reeves was born on September 2, 1964, in Beirut, Lebanon. His mother, Patricia Taylor, was an English costume designer and entertainer, while his father, Samuel Nowlin Reeves Jr., was an American geologist with Hawaiian, Chinese, English, and Portuguese heritage.
Following his parents’ early separation, his father became largely absent from his life. His mother relocated the family to Sydney, then New York City, and ultimately settled in Toronto, Canada, where Reeves grew up and gained citizenship.
Reeves attended multiple high schools and struggled academically due to dyslexia. However, he excelled in athletics as an ice hockey goaltender, earning the moniker “The Wall” and briefly contemplating a professional sports career.
By his teenage years, Reeves pivoted toward acting, performing in theater productions such as Romeo and Juliet. Choosing to commit to acting full-time, he departed high school prior to graduation and relocated to Los Angeles.
Keanu Reeves Net Worth 2026 – Early Acting Work
Reeves began his professional journey appearing in Canadian television shows, commercial spots, theater projects, and short films. He briefly served as a youth correspondent on the CBC program Going Great and had a role in the TV series Hangin’ In.
His notable feature film breakthrough occurred in the 1986 hockey drama Youngblood, starring Rob Lowe and Patrick Swayze, where Reeves leveraged his athletic background to portray a goalie from Québec.
Later that year, he gained critical notice for his performance in River’s Edge, a dark drama centering on teenagers reacting to a peer’s murder. This role solidified his reputation as a talented young dramatic lead. He followed this success with parts in Dangerous Liaisons, Permanent Record, and Ron Howard’s ensemble comedy Parenthood.
Keanu Reeves Net Worth 2026 – Commercial Success: Bill & Ted and Action Breakthroughs
Reeves achieved mainstream stardom in 1989 playing Theodore “Ted” Logan in the sci-fi comedy Bill & Ted’s Excellent Adventure. The film became a runaway hit with a major cult following. He re-teamed with co-star Alex Winter for Bill & Ted’s Bogus Journey in 1991, and returned to the roles nearly 30 years later in Bill & Ted Face the Music.
While the character of “Ted” launched his fame, it also threatened to typecast him as an easygoing slacker. Reeves spent the early 1990s taking on diverse roles to redefine his image.
In 1991, he co-starred with Patrick Swayze as FBI Agent Johnny Utah in Kathryn Bigelow’s Point Break. That same year, he starred with River Phoenix in Gus Van Sant’s indie drama My Own Private Idaho.
He went on to play Jonathan Harker in Francis Ford Coppola’s Bram Stoker’s Dracula and appeared as Don John in Kenneth Branagh’s Much Ado About Nothing. His additional credits from this era include Little Buddha, A Walk in the Clouds, and Johnny Mnemonic.
Keanu Reeves Net Worth 2026 – Speed and A-List Prominence
Reeves achieved top-tier action star status in 1994 with Speed. Playing LAPD officer Jack Traven—who must keep a city transit bus traveling over 50 mph to prevent a bomb from detonating—he starred opposite Sandra Bullock. The film earned two Academy Awards and grossed over $350 million worldwide.
While the massive success of Speed elevated his market value, Reeves famously turned down an offer to star in Speed 2: Cruise Control because he was unimpressed by the script. Moving the premise to a cruise ship, the sequel flopped critically and commercially.
Reeves continued exploring different genres, leading the romantic drama A Walk in the Clouds, the sci-fi action film Chain Reaction, and the supernatural thriller The Devil’s Advocate, alongside Al Pacino and Charlize Theron.
Keanu Reeves Net Worth 2026 – The Matrix Era
The defining epoch of Reeves’ career arrived when he was cast as programmer Thomas Anderson (Neo) in the 1999 sci-fi phenomenon The Matrix.
Fusing martial arts, philosophical themes, cyberpunk aesthetics, and revolutionary visual techniques, the film pulled in more than $460 million globally and won four Oscars. Reeves completed intense martial arts conditioning to execute most of his stunts. Neo’s iconic imagery—the choice between red and blue pills, cascading green code, and “bullet time” action—became legendary pop-culture staples.
Reeves reprised the role in back-to-back sequels released in 2003: The Matrix Reloaded and The Matrix Revolutions. Reloaded brought in $740 million globally, becoming the top-earning entry in the series. Nearly two decades later, he and co-star Carrie-Anne Moss reunited for The Matrix Resurrections.
Keanu Reeves Net Worth 2026 – Matrix Compensation Breakdown
- The Matrix (1999): Reeves received a $10 million upfront base salary paired with backend revenue participation, bringing his total earnings to $35 million.
- The Matrix Reloaded & Revolutions (2003): He was paid a $15 million base salary for each sequel, plus a 15% backend profit split. Recorded as a single back-to-back production, his combined payout for the two sequels landed between $90 million and $200 million.
- Cumulative Franchise Pay: Taking the original and the two sequels together, his total compensation reached $250 million.
(Note: While internet rumors frequently state he gave away his earnings to crew members, Reeves actually adjusted his contractual terms so production funds could be redirected toward special effects and costume budgets, and he personally gifted Harley-Davidson motorcycles to members of his stunt team.)
Keanu Reeves Net Worth 2026 – Transition Period & Return to Action
In the years following the original Matrix trilogy, Reeves divided his time between major studio releases and independent projects.
He played the antihero occult detective in 2005’s Constantine, re-teamed with Sandra Bullock for 2006’s The Lake House, and starred in Richard Linklater’s rotoscope-animated Philip K. Dick adaptation A Scanner Darkly.
His other work from this phase included Street Kings, The Day the Earth Stood Still, The Private Lives of Pippa Lee, and Henry’s Crime. In 2013, he made his directorial debut with the martial arts feature Man of Tai Chi.
Keanu Reeves Net Worth 2026 – The John Wick Phenomenon
In 2014, Reeves took on the titular role of retired hitman John Wick, embarking on a quest for vengeance following the murder of his dog and the theft of his Mustang.
Produced on a modest budget, the first John Wick earned $89 million globally and blew up on home media. Its intricate world-building and synchronized gun-fu choreography established a major new franchise.
Subsequent installments grew progressively larger:
- John Wick: Chapter 2 (2017)
- John Wick: Chapter 3 – Parabellum (2019)
- John Wick: Chapter 4 (2023) – Grossed over $440 million globally.
Across four mainline films, the franchise surpassed $1 billion in total earnings. Beyond extensive firearms, driving, and martial arts training, Reeves took on a producer role in later installments, granting him backend equity in the franchise. He also made an appearance in the spinoff film From the World of John Wick: Ballerina.
Keanu Reeves Net Worth 2026 – Voice Roles and Other Projects
Reeves appeared as a comedic version of himself in the Netflix feature Always Be My Maybe and voiced stunt rider Duke Caboom in Pixar’s $1 billion hit Toy Story 4.
He provided the voice for Batman in DC League of Super-Pets and Shadow the Hedgehog in Sonic the Hedgehog 3 (which generated nearly $500 million globally). Additionally, he portrayed the angel Gabriel in Aziz Ansari’s comedy Good Fortune.
Keanu Reeves Net Worth 2026 – Film Salary & Career Earnings Summary
| Film & Year | Reported Earnings / Base Pay | Key Notes |
| Youngblood (1986) | $3,000 | Feature film debut |
| Bill & Ted’s Excellent Adventure (1989) | $95,000 | Commercial breakthrough |
| Speed (1994) | $1,200,000 | Equates to ~$2M adjusted for inflation |
| Johnny Mnemonic (1995) | $2,000,000 | Cyberpunk lead role |
| The Devil’s Advocate (1997) | $8,000,000 | Took a pay cut to bring Al Pacino onboard |
| The Matrix (1999) | $35,000,000 – $45,000,000 | $10M upfront + 10% backend gross |
| The Replacements (2000) | $12,500,000 | Deferred salary so Gene Hackman could join |
| The Matrix Reloaded & Revolutions (2003) | $90,000,000 – $200,000,000 | $15M upfront each + 15% backend split |
| John Wick (2014) | $1,000,000 – $2,000,000 | Upfront base salary |
| John Wick: Chapter 2 (2017) | $2,000,000 – $2,500,000 | Upfront base salary |
| John Wick: Chapter 4 (2023) | $15,000,000 | Equates to ~$39,473 per word (380 spoken words) |
- Notable Rejected Role: Passed on an $11 million payday for Speed 2: Cruise Control in 1997 to focus on touring with his rock band.
- Salary Voluntary Adjustments: Accepted reduced upfront pay on both The Devil’s Advocate and The Replacements so producers could cast Al Pacino and Gene Hackman, respectively.
Musical Career, Business Ventures & Writing
- Dogstar: Reeves plays bass guitar in the alternative rock group alongside Bret Domrose (vocals/guitar) and Robert Mailhouse (drums). The group formed in the 1990s, releasing Our Little Visionary and Happy Ending, touring internationally, and opening for legends like David Bowie and Bon Jovi. After a two-decade pause, they reunited to release Somewhere Between the Power Lines and Palm Trees in 2023, followed by All In Now in 2026, alongside active touring.
- ARCH Motorcycle: Co-founded in 2011 with designer Gard Hollinger, this California-based firm manufactures high-end, custom-tailored power motorcycles. The duo also produced the innovation documentary series Visionaries.
- Company Films: A production company co-established with Stephen Hamel, responsible for backing projects like Henry’s Crime, Side by Side, Man of Tai Chi, and Replicas.
- Publishing & Writing: Co-founded X Artists’ Books with partner Alexandra Grant, co-creating art books like Ode to Happiness and Shadows. In 2021, Reeves launched the comic book series BRZRKR with Matt Kindt, later co-authoring the companion novel The Book of Elsewhere with fantasy writer China Miéville.
Keanu Reeves Net Worth 2026 – Philanthropy
Following his sister Kim’s struggle with leukemia, Reeves established a private charitable foundation that finances cancer research and pediatric hospital programs. He intentionally keeps his personal name detached from most charitable donations. He has consistently supported entities like Stand Up to Cancer, SickKids Foundation, St. Jude Children’s Research Hospital, PETA, and Camp Rainbow Gold, alongside auctioning personal memorabilia for charity drives.
Keanu Reeves Net Worth 2026 – Personal Life & Real Estate
Personal Milestones
During the late 1990s, Reeves was in a relationship with actress and production assistant Jennifer Syme. Tragically, their daughter, Ava Archer Syme-Reeves, was stillborn in December 1999. The grief contributed to their temporary breakup, though they later reconciled. In April 2001, Syme died in a vehicle crash in Los Angeles.
Reeves maintained a private personal life for nearly two decades before going public with artist Alexandra Grant at the LACMA Art + Film Gala in 2019.
Real Estate Investments
Unlike many Hollywood figures, Reeves refrained from acquiring property for much of his early career, residing in rented houses and extended-stay hotel suites (most notably the Chateau Marmont in West Hollywood) throughout the 1980s, 1990s, and early 2000s.
- Mother’s Home: In 1998, before buying a home for himself, he spent $2.45 million to purchase a Los Angeles home for his mother, Patricia Taylor.
- New York Residence: In the early 2000s, he bought four separate units inside The Prasada (a historic co-op at 50 Central Park West), merging them into a single 3,000-square-foot, 11th-floor residence with Central Park views.
- Hollywood Hills Estate: In 2003, at age 38, Reeves purchased his primary residence for $4.85 million. Located above West Hollywood, the 5,600-square-foot contemporary single-story home sits on 0.41 acres and features floor-to-ceiling glass, an open inner courtyard, and a 50-foot infinity lap pool. The home is currently valued between $8 million and $10 million.
